Understanding LA Weekly Magazine
Overview of LA Weekly Magazine Audience and Reach
LA Weekly is an iconic publication that serves as a cultural touchstone for the city of Los Angeles. With a diverse readership that spans various demographics, from young creatives to seasoned professionals, LA Weekly provides a platform for voices that matter. This magazine also covers everything from local news and food to arts and entertainment, making it a prime destination for those looking to connect with the LA lifestyle.

Connecting with the Right Contacts
Researching the Editorial Team at LA Weekly Magazine
Understanding who the key players are at LA Weekly is crucial. Research the editorial team, paying close attention to the writers who cover topics relevant to your story. Familiarize yourself with their work to tailor your pitch accordingly.
Tips for Reaching Out to LA Weekly Magazine: Email Etiquette and Best Practices
When reaching out, keep your email professional yet personable. Use a clear subject line, introduce yourself succinctly, and explain why your story is good enough for LA Weekly. Always proofread your email to avoid any errors.
Importance of Following Up Without Being Pushy
If you don’t hear back after your initial pitch, it’s okay to follow up after a week or so. A polite reminder can often be the nudge an editor needs to consider your story. However, be mindful of their time and avoid coming across as overly persistent.

Timing Your Pitch
Best Times to Pitch Your Story to LA Weekly Magazine
Timing is crucial when pitching your story. Consider the editorial calendar of LA Weekly and align your pitch with upcoming themes or issues. For instance, if you’re into local music scene, pitching around major music events can be beneficial.
Understanding Seasonal Trends in Content
Certain stories resonate more during specific times of the year. For example, summer might be ideal for events and festivals, while the fall could focus on new art exhibitions. Tailor your pitch to align with these trends.
Importance of Current Events and Local Happenings
Incorporate timely issues or events into your pitch. If there’s a local festival, community initiative, or trending topic relevant to your story, make sure to highlight it. Editors appreciate pitches that feel current and relevant.

Following Up: Dos and Don’ts
When and How to Follow Up After Your Initial Pitch to LA Weekly Magazine
If you don’t receive a response, wait about a week before sending a gentle follow-up email. Keep it short and reiterate your interest in sharing your story with LA Weekly.
Common Mistakes to Avoid in Follow-Up Communications
Avoid being overly aggressive or impatient. Editors are busy, and a single follow-up is generally courteous. Don’t spam their inbox with multiple messages.
How to Maintain a Professional Relationship with LA Weekly Magazine Editors
Whether they will accept your pitch or not, always express gratitude for their time. If you build a rapport, you may have opportunities to pitch again in the future.
